WalkthroughThis update introduces new URL hash parameters for search query state (case sensitivity, regex, and query string), synchronizes these parameters between the URL and the application's store, and adds a share button to the SearchTabPanel that copies a permalink containing these search parameters. It also updates relevant type definitions and error messages. Changes
